Quarterly Planning Note — Branch Managers

Quick update on the Keldan Partners term sheet: terms came back better than expected, with a three-year revenue share and co-marketing funds for branches in the Ostervale corridor. Legal at Brightmoor Retail Group is reviewing exclusivity language this week. Keep this off branch floors until signing. For planning, assume the partnership lands mid-quarter. Below is a confidential note on where this fits in our broader plans.

management briefing: Project Ulavan slips by two quarters because of the staffing delay.

### Key Ceremony Checklist — Item 7: Webhook Retry Semantics (Relaygate)

Confirm retry policy before sealing keys: exponential backoff, max five attempts, dead-letter after final failure. Idempotency keys required on all deliveries. Future maintainers: changing these values invalidates the signed config bundle. To re-sign, unlock the ceremony vault with the quorum tool. Enter the recovery passphrase directly below.

unlock words, yawig-kagef: gordor-holvan-ulaael-pramir-ulaiel-tamdor

# Digest scheduler env — Pinfold batch mailer.
# Digests compile hourly; sends fire at the window set by
# DIGEST_SEND_WINDOW (UTC, 24h). Don't shrink the window below
# 15 minutes or the queue backs up. Contractors: changes here
# need a restart of the scheduler pod, nothing else. The mailer
# authenticates to the Kestrel relay with a credential, and the
# line directly below sets it.

env line for fafof-fahag: LEDGER_TOKEN5=f8790